pandas绘制时间跨度聚合列

时间:2016-06-13 14:54:45

标签: pandas plot

我正在尝试使用时间跨度绘制数据。 我正在使用pandas数据帧 时间跨度足够直接但是 在所有示例中,它们都会生成符合时间跨度的数据。

如何生成时间跨度图,汇总列中的数据以匹配时间范围?

目前我正在将我的索引转换为时间序列并将值绘制为列值,如下所示

 series = pd.Series(df['value'], index=df.index)

 series.resample('12T',how='sum')

 series.plot()

  plt.show()

然而,0和1的值似乎没有得到平均值,而是从0到1或在图表中反转,而不是在指定的时间跨度内显示平均值

1 个答案:

答案 0 :(得分:0)

答案非常简单。

我正在策划这个系列而不是系列,其频率日期如下:

 series = pd.Series(df['value'], index=df.index)

  w = series.resample('1T',how='sum')


  w.plot()

  plt.show()